Не мога да разбера къде бъркам

0 гласа
61 прегледа
попитан 25 май в PHP от marto0819 (120 точки)

Include <iosstream>

Using namespace std;

struct Item {

    int info;

    Item *next;

};

typedef Item* Point;

Point Head;

void Create(Point &Head){

Point    Last, P; Last=NULL;

char    ch;

cout<<" Нов елемент (Y/N) ?:";

cin >> ch;

while (ch == 'Y' || ch == 'y') {

P = new Item;

cin >> P->info;

P->next=NULL;    /* еквивалентно на (*P).next=NULL; */

if (Head == NULL)     Head = P;

    else    Last->next = P;

Last = P;

cout<<" Нов елемент (Y/N) ?:";

cin >> ch;

}    // while

}    //Create

void Create(Point &Head){

Point    Last, P; Last=NULL;

char    ch;

cout<<" Нов елемент (Y/N) ?:";

cin >> ch;

while (ch == 'Y' || ch == 'y') {

P = new Item;

cin >> P->info;

P->next=NULL;    /* еквивалентно на (*P).next=NULL; */

if (Head == NULL)     Head = P;

    else    Last->next = P;

Last = P;

cout<<" Нов елемент (Y/N) ?:";

cin >> ch;

}    // while

}    //Create


 

void main()

Point Head=NULL;     

Create(Head);

Return 0;

}

Моля влез или се регистрирай за да отговориш на този въпрос.

...